Front and Rear Brake Rotors
At Richmond BMW Midlothian in Midlothian, VA, we explain clearly how front and rear rotors function and why they wear differently on a 2022 BMW 2 Series. Front rotors handle the bulk of braking force because weight shifts forward during deceleration; that extra load means front rotors and pads often show wear sooner than the rear. Rear rotors provide balance, parking brake function, and stabilization—so their maintenance matters for consistent pedal feel and ABS performance. Our factory-trained technicians diagnose whether a rotor should be resurfaced or replaced by measuring thickness, runout, and heat damage. 2022 BMW 2 Series Brake Rotors
Understanding how the 2022 BMW 2 Series brake rotors work helps you protect stopping power and resale value. Rotors convert kinetic energy to heat through friction with brake pads; proper rotor surface, thickness, and ventilation are essential to prevent fade under heavy use.
